We look forward to showing you Velaris, but first we'd like to know a little bit about you.
The Velaris Team
August 23, 2024
Discover everything you need to do to onboard a customer in this detailed checklist for CSMs.
As a SaaS business, your onboarding process is a crucial stage that sets the tone for your entire customer relationship.
Effective onboarding not only helps customers understand and utilize the software but also drives user engagement, customer satisfaction, and long-term retention.
That’s why a well-structured onboarding checklist is essential for guiding new users through the initial stages of their journey – ensuring they realize the full value of the product.
This article outlines a comprehensive SaaS onboarding checklist, designed to help your customers transition seamlessly from sign-up to successful product use.
Additionally, we’ll explore how Velaris, a leading Customer Success (CS) platform, can complement your onboarding process, ensuring every step is optimized for maximum impact.
Creating an effective onboarding process is not a one-size-fits-all endeavor. Each company has unique business outcomes and diverse customer learning styles that need to be taken into account.
However, there are several key components that every onboarding process should include, regardless of customization. These essential elements ensure a comprehensive and structured approach, helping to set your customers up for success right from the start.
With that, here are nine key components that make a well-rounded onboarding checklist:
The success of onboarding begins well before the first interaction with your customer. Preparation is key to ensuring a smooth and efficient process.
One of the first steps is gathering comprehensive customer information, such as company details, user roles, and specific needs. This data allows you to tailor the onboarding experience to their unique requirements and set the stage for a more personalized approach.
Designating an account manager is equally crucial. This person will serve as the primary point of contact, guiding the customer through each phase of onboarding and addressing any questions or concerns – building trust by providing a consistent and reliable touchpoint.
In addition, creating a detailed onboarding plan can help ensure that nothing is overlooked. This plan should outline key milestones, deliverables, and timelines.
By proactively preparing and organizing these elements, your CS team can foster a positive first impression and set the foundation for a successful and lasting partnership.
A welcome pack is the first step in the onboarding process. This introductory package can include a warm greeting, an overview of the product, tools to help users learn more about the platform, and clear next steps.
By linking to helpful resources, such as getting started guides, video tutorials, and customer support contact information, you’ll provide customers with the essential information they need to get started and set the tone for your relationship.
You can even personalize this interaction by tailoring your resources and recommendations to their specific use case or industry.
Guiding users through the account setup process is crucial. This includes filling out profile information, setting preferences, and integrating with other tools if necessary. A smooth setup experience reduces friction and helps users feel more comfortable.
To do this, provide step-by-step instructions, tool-tips, and progress indicators to guide users through each stage. If you’re able to, include data import options from other platforms to streamline the transition. This will make it easier for your product to fit into their daily workflows.
A product tour introduces users to the core features and functionalities of the software. Interactive tours or video tutorials can be highly effective in demonstrating how to use the product and highlighting key benefits.
Break down the tour into manageable sections, each focusing on a different aspect of the software. Use in-app messaging or pop-ups to guide users through their first interactions, ensuring they don't miss any critical features.
Encouraging users to complete their first task within the software can help them see immediate value. This could be anything from creating their first project to sending their first email campaign.
The best way to do this is by tailoring your recommendations to their Business Outcomes. What’s the first step that can help them get there? By identifying a task that contributes to their final goal, you’ll be able to showcase immediate value in your product.
Celebrating these milestones also encourages continued use, so offer incentives or rewards for completing initial tasks, such as badges, points, or discounts. After users complete their tasks, follow up with personalized emails congratulating them on their progress and suggesting next steps.
Providing access to a variety of educational resources, such as webinars, FAQs, knowledge bases, and community forums, ensures users have the support they need. This doesn’t just apply in terms of information, but also learning styles.
While some customers may be readers, others might prefer visual guides or something more interactive, like a live Q&A session that addresses common questions and provides deeper insights into the product.
By catering to these different needs, you’ll ensure users troubleshoot issues independently and learn more about advanced features.
Just ensure to regularly update these resources with new content that is easily searchable and accessible.
Regularly checking in with your customers can help maintain engagement and address any concerns. These touchpoints provide an opportunity to gather feedback, offer additional assistance, and ensure users are progressing smoothly.
The high-touch approach to this would be setting up calls with customers, but for a low-touch approach, you could send out automated emails personalized for each stage of the customer journey.
Schedule these check-ins at strategic intervals, such as one week, one month, and three months after onboarding, and use them to discuss user goals, challenges, and any additional features that may benefit them.
Collecting feedback from users about their onboarding experience is essential for continuous improvement. Surveys, feedback forms, and direct conversations can provide valuable insights into areas that need enhancement.
For example, with a Customer Satisfaction (CSAT) survey or a Net Promoter Score (NPS), you could ask customers to rate their onboarding experience with your team. This would allow you to gauge your performance and identify areas for improvement.
Develop a systematic approach for collecting, analyzing, and addressing feedback, ensuring it is integrated into your product development and support strategies. By acting on feedback promptly, you’ll show users their opinions are valued and lead to tangible improvements.
As users become more familiar with the software, offering advanced training sessions can help them unlock the full potential of the product. This could include personalized training, in-depth tutorials, or specialized webinars.
Tailor advanced training to different user roles and industries, focusing on specific use cases and advanced features. You can also provide certification programs or badges for users who complete advanced training to recognize their expertise and encourage deeper engagement.
If you’re still confused about how to use an onboarding checklist practically, here’s a tentative one we’ve put together as an example.
This template outlines essential tasks that can serve as a foundation for your onboarding efforts. Remember, the key to success is customizing each task to align with your specific goals and the needs of your customers – so use this checklist as a starting point, and adapt it to create a personalized onboarding journey for your business.
This template serves as a comprehensive guide to ensure all aspects of the onboarding process are covered, providing new users with a smooth and supportive introduction to your SaaS product.
Next, we’ll get into some useful tips to enhance your onboarding checklist.
Our SaaS onboarding checklist is a good foundation, but here are four additional factors that can make it even better:
Tailoring the onboarding process to individual user needs and preferences can enhance the experience. Personalized content, recommendations, and support can make users feel valued and understood.
Use data from user profiles and interactions to customize onboarding messages, tutorials, and support resources. You can even use this data to recommend specific features, workflows, or integrations based on user behavior and goals.
Automating repetitive tasks in the onboarding process can save time and ensure consistency. Automated emails, reminders, and tutorials can keep users engaged without overwhelming your support team.
Set up automated workflows for key onboarding stages, such as welcome emails, product tours, and milestone celebrations. You can also use marketing automation tools to segment users and deliver personalized content based on their progress and interactions.
Onboarding should not end after the initial stages. Continuous support, through regular updates, check-ins, and new feature introductions, ensures users remain engaged and satisfied.
Establish a support framework that includes regular communication, such as newsletters, update notifications, and Customer Success check-ins. You should also consider providing ongoing training opportunities, such as advanced webinars, user conferences, and peer-to-peer learning sessions.
Monitoring user progress during onboarding helps identify areas where users may be struggling. Analytics and tracking tools can provide insights into user behavior and highlight opportunities for improvement.
Implement detailed tracking mechanisms to monitor user interactions with the product, such as feature usage, task completion, and support requests. Use this data to identify patterns, optimize onboarding workflows, and proactively address user challenges.
Now that you understand what your SaaS onboarding checklist needs to entail, let’s explore how Velaris integrates with it.
Velaris is a powerful CS platform that offers a suite of tools designed to streamline and enhance your onboarding checklist. Here are six ways it can help:
Velaris allows you to create customized onboarding journeys tailored to different user segments. By leveraging customer data, you can segment users based on criteria such as industry, role, and usage patterns. This enables the delivery of personalized content, recommendations, and support, ensuring each user receives relevant information at every stage of the onboarding process.
With Velaris, you can automate key onboarding tasks, ensuring consistency and efficiency. Automated workflows can handle repetitive tasks such as sending welcome emails, scheduling check-ins, and triggering educational content. This allows your team to focus on more complex and high-value activities.
Velaris provides robust tracking and analytics capabilities, allowing you to monitor user progress throughout the onboarding process. By identifying bottlenecks and areas where users may struggle, you can make data-driven decisions to enhance the onboarding experience.
Velaris makes it easy to gather and manage user feedback. Integrated surveys and feedback forms allow you to collect valuable insights directly from users, enabling you to continuously refine and improve the onboarding process.
Velaris supports ongoing engagement beyond the initial onboarding phase. Tools for regular check-ins, updates, and advanced training sessions help ensure users remain engaged and continue to derive value from the product.
Velaris helps you celebrate user milestones, reinforcing positive behavior and encouraging continued engagement. By recognizing and rewarding users for completing key tasks, you can build confidence and satisfaction.
By offering personalized onboarding journeys, automated workflows, progress tracking, feedback collection, continuous engagement, and milestone celebrations, Velaris ensures that each user receives a tailored, efficient, and engaging experience.
A comprehensive and well-executed onboarding process is critical for the success of any SaaS product.
By following the checklist outlined above, you can ensure your customers have a smooth and enjoyable journey from sign-up to successful product use.
Leveraging tools like Velaris can further enhance the onboarding experience, driving engagement, satisfaction, and long-term retention. Remember, the goal is not just to onboard users but to transform them into loyal advocates for your product.
Book a demo with Velaris today to see how it can smoothen your onboarding process and help keep your customers happy from the start.
The Velaris Team
Velaris will eliminate your team’s troubles and produce better experiences for your customers…and set up only takes minutes. What’s not to love? It’s, well, super!
Request a demo